This topic is really outside my normal duties but about 3 years ago, I was wrangled into building a public facing app that would show the public our ADA inventory information. I just rebuilt it with Experience Builder because of forced migration (thanks ESRI) and you can poke around in it here: https://gis.snoco.org/portal/apps/experiencebuilder/experience/?id=f1d7bd5e44ae466c953994a37c074128 The data in this application is old and kind of severed from the current workflow. We need to reconcile this and incorporate the new information but there's only so much I can do as I have to force migrate several apps before my IT shuts down our original Portal instance at the end of this month. Anyways. as I attempt to recall how this worked, the staff that were doing the inventory may still have been doing clipboard attribute collection and using a consumer level GPS for some field data collection. All the data was actively maintained in a file geoDatabase and I had a cut pulled out and published publicly in order to build the original WAB application. Since that time, my organization has adopted an asset management system (Cartegraph) and now the ADA inventory information is being captured in there so field staff are using tablets to capture location & attribute information and it's all stored in there. Because of the drastic change, the current workflow has been "date forward" and doesn't contain that historical stuff yet. I've been told there are some issues about duplicate features with respect to merging old and new data but I'm not really clear on that part. Yes and no..Within the default Map Viewer interface, there isn't a way. The most direct way I can think of is if you have access to the REST endpoint of the map service. You can query against the service with a WHERE clause (OBJECTID=77 or TYPE='Active' etc) and have the REST query return the results in JSON format. Then you can copy/paste the JSON into a text file and then import it back into desktop GIS using the geoprocessing tool for JSON to Feature.

I don't have a specific workflow to share but, in 3.X API based apps (classic web map, WebApp Builder apps, etc), once the ESRI map is loaded it was possible to convert the map layer of interest to JSON. Feature layers had a method called toJson and I have successfully used this to extract a layer from a map where the REST endpoint was not directly accessible. You would open the web developer tools of your browser, and then access the map object using the console line input and have the JSON dump out to the console. Once you had that, copy/paste that into a new text document with a JSON file suffix and then you could proceed like you described. I'm not sure if the 4.x API has an equivalent method to call.

Someone else might have a more elegant solution but this should work: var theInput = 'Alpha Bravo County';
var inputArray = Split(theInput, " ");
var theOutput = '';
for (var i in inputArray) {
if (Upper(inputArray[i]) != 'COUNTY') {
theOutput = theOutput + ' ' + inputArray[i];
}
}
return Trim(theOutput); I'm using the Upper function just to be safe in case there's any mix of upper / lower / proper case field values (but everyone is always consistent with attribute entry, amirite?) Steve

In Illustrator, try exporting the graphic to CAD format (DXF) and then bring import it into ArcGIS Pro and then save it as a feature layer. It won't have spatial attributes but you can just bring it in and manually move it and scale the feature once you have it into GIS.
